British cyclist Chris Froome has won a bronze medal in the men's individual time trial event at the Rio Olympics.
It comes just weeks after he won the Tour de France for a third time.
The 54.5km time trial in Brazil was won by Swiss cyclist Fabian Cancellara in a time of 1:12:15.42.

Froome was a minute behind, finishing in 1:13:17.54, while Dutchman Tom Dumoulin took silver in 1:13:02.83.
